What is the B1 Visa?
The B1 visa is a momentary visa developed for individuals who need to travel to the United States for business-related activities. These activities can include, however are not restricted to:
Attending organization meetings or conferencesWorking out agreementsConsulting with organization partnersTaking part in short-term trainingSettling estates
It is necessary to keep in mind that the B1 visa is not intended for employment or extended stays. If you prepare to operate in the U.S., you will need a different type of visa, such as an H-1B visa for specialized employment.
Eligibility Criteria
To be qualified for a B1 visa, applicants must fulfill the following criteria:
Business Purpose: The primary function of the journey must be business-related.Momentary Stay: The candidate must plan to stay in the U.S. for a restricted period and have a house outside the U.S. to which they will return.Financial Means: The applicant must have enough monetary resources to cover the costs of the journey and remain in the U.S.No Intent to Immigrate: The applicant should not have the objective to immigrate to the U.S.Application Process
The B1 visa application process includes a number of steps:
Determine Eligibility: Ensure that your journey fulfills the criteria for a B1 visa.Complete Form DS-160: Fill out the Online Nonimmigrant Visa Application, Form DS-160. This type can be finished online and must be submitted digitally.Pay the Application Fee: Pay the non-refundable visa application cost, which is currently ₤ 160 GBP.Set up an Interview: Schedule an interview at the U.S. Embassy or Consulate in your country of home. You can schedule the interview through the U.S. Department of State's visa consultation system.Prepare Required Documents: Gather all necessary files, including:A legitimate passportA printed confirmation page of the DS-160 kindA recent passport-sized photoEvidence of financial waysPaperwork of business function of your trip (e.g., invite letters, conference agendas, etc)Attend the Interview: Attend the visa interview at the U.S. Embassy or Consulate. During the interview, a consular officer will evaluate your application and supporting files.Wait on a Decision: After the interview, the consular officer will inform you of the choice. If authorized, your visa will be issued, and you will get it at the address you offered.Duration of Stay
The duration of stay for a B1 visa is normally figured out by the consular officer at the time of the visa interview. Generally, B1 visa holders are granted a stay of up to 6 months, which can be extended in particular cases. However, the real length of stay will be shown on the I-94 Arrival/Departure Record, which is offered upon entry to the U.S.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Can I obtain a B1 visa if I am currently in the U.S. on a different visa?
No, you can not make an application for a B1 visa while in the U.S. on a different visa. You must return to your home nation and apply through the regular process at a U.S. Embassy or Consulate.
2. Can I operate in the U.S. with a B1 visa?
No, the B1 visa does not authorize employment in the U.S. If you plan to work, you will need to obtain a work visa, such as an H-1B visa.
3. Can I bring my household with me on a B1 visa?
No, the B1 visa is for company purposes only. If your relative wish to accompany you, they will need to obtain a B2 visa, which is for tourism and visits.
4. What occurs if I overstay my B1 visa?
Overstaying your B1 visa can have serious repercussions, consisting of being disallowed from re-entering the U.S. and being disqualified for future visas. It is essential to leave the U.S. by the date defined on your I-94.
5. Can I change my status from B1 to another visa while in the U.S.?
Yes, it is possible to change your status from B1 to another visa while in the U.S., but you need to apply through U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S) and fulfill the eligibility requirements for the brand-new visa.
